This roport Is Intondod 10 provldo tho Informallon nocossary lot you and tho Clly Council 10 ,
I
discuss oxpanslon of tho oxlstlng Iowa CIIy Tran.,11 routo sltUcluro. WhIlo this roport allompts 10
roll ably lorocasltho ganoral routo oxpanslon proposal and assoclatod costs, It doos nol dosetlbo I
lho spoclflo slroots or limo polnls 01 tho oxpanded aorvlco. Tho apoclfio Information will bo I ,I
dovolopod altor Council approval 01 this oxpanslon concopl. ;<
f
!Iacknround I
I
Tho curront routo and sorvlco structuro has boon In placo slnco July, 1987. It consists 0114 ' '
routos wllh sotvlco from 6 a.m. 10 II p,m. Monday threugh Frlday and from 6 a.m. 10 7 p.m.
Saturdays. During tho momlng and allomoon poak porlods, sotvlco Is ovory half.hour and onco
por hour In lho mld.day, ovonlngs, and Saturdays. AI n~hl, savoral pairs 01 routos aro comblnod
Into l8Igot, slnglo routos. For oaso 01 uso and undot81andlng, all Iowa CIIy Transit routos loavo
downtown olthor at :00 and :30 or :15 and :45.
Tho primary aroa being consldorod lot oxpanded sotvlco In this roport Is gonorally doscrlbed as
soulhwosllowa Clly. It consists of tho Ty'n Cao Subdivision, Including sltoots off Mormon Trok
such as Cao Drlvo, Cambria Court, Dolon Placo, Abor Avonuo, Plaonvlow, and Gryn Drlvo. Tho
aroa would also Includo tho dovalopmonts wosl 01 Mormon Trok auch as Waldon Placo, Waldon
I Road, and Waldon Courl (soo Flguro 1, Aroa 1). Dopondlng on tho oxacl routo choson,lt may
also bo posslblo 10 sorvo lho Abor Avonuo.Eallng Drlvo aroa wosl 01 Sunsot Slroot (soo Flguro
I, Aroa 2). Aroa 1 currontly has 490 dwolllng units olthor built or undor consltUctlon whllo Aroa
I 2 has an addlllonal216 units. Tho City Council as woll as Transit Dopartmont has rocolvod many
roquosts lor transit sorvlco Irom tho rosldonts olthoso aroas. Tho closasl oxlsllng routo 10 Aroa 'I
lis tho cornor 01 Mormon Trok Road and Bonton Strool and for rosldonts 01 Aroa 2,tho noarosl "
slop Is at Sunsot Stroot and Donblgh Drlvo. Whon WOSlport Plaza opons It will bo sorved by lho
r: oxlstlng Wardway reulo. I;
n I
~ ,
,
l! I
~
~ All oxlsllng Iowa City Transit routos aro ollhor 30 or 45 mlnutos In longth. Tho proposod
,
k i
, soulhwosllowa Clly routo would bo 45 mlnutosln longlh. It Is also proposad tho now routo havo I
"
II lho same characlorlsllcs as tho oxlsllng routos . half.hour hoadways during lho poak porlod and ,
il I-
i' hourly mld.day, ovonlng, and Saturday sotvlco. I bollovo thallnlllallng a now routo al a lowor ,
~ sorvlco lovolthan lho romalndor of tho ayatom Immodlatoly dlmlnlshos tho now routo'a chancos I.
g for succoss.

Tho proposod soulhwostlowa City routo would also bonofll othor wosl aldo routos which aro
currontly evorcrewdod. During poak tlmos, tho Mark IV and Hawkoyo Apartmonts routos aro
oporatlng at crush loads. During Inclomont woathot, potions havo boon passod by al bus slops
duo to tho bus alroady bolng full. As Ttanslt Managor, I havo rocolvod numorous complaints
rogardlng tho ovorcrowdod condlflons. Tho preposod routo weuld bo alruclurod so that It would
rollovo aomo 01 tho prossuro ofllho oxlstlng routos.
In ordor 10 add one now 45.mlnuto route and oporato It at houriy and hall.houriy hoactNays posos
a complox malhomallcal task. Howovor, tho transll stall has dotormlnod thai It Is posslblo by (I)
adding two additional busos and (2) oxtondlng one oxlstlng 30.mlnuto routo to 45.mlnulos In
longth. By doing this all oxlstlng Iowa City Transit routos and tho now touto would oporalo on a
slmllat schodulo systom.
Making an oxlstlng 30.mlnuto toulo 45 mlnulos In longth would also gonorato slgnlflconl bono fils.
I om preposlng that Iho Mall routo bo solodod lor tho oxtonslan. This would allow two
onhancomonls to tho prosonl roulo. Ono, tho Easldalo Plaza could rocolvo rogular transit
sorvlco. (Tho CIIy Ceuncll has Inqulrod about this ptovlously.) Two, transit aorvlco could also
bo provldod tho Industrial park aroa. Tho JCCOG Transportation Planning Division Is currontly
working on a BDI omployors' survoy to dotormlno tho lovol 01 domand ler bus aorvlco.
Yohlclo Roaulromonf~
In Ordor to Implomont this ptoposal, two additional busos would bo p1acod on tho sltools. Iowa
CIIy Transit has 19 'modom' and 2 'old look' busos In tho flooL Currontly, during tho poak hour,
thoro aro 14 busos on tho sttoot. Tho Transll Dopartmonl and Equlpmonl Division 1001 thai tho
oxpandod sorvlco can be achlovod wllh tho oxlstlng fioot; howovor, tho 'old look' busos will bo
placod bock In acllvo sorvlco.
Tho addition 01 one 45.mlnuto toulo and 15 mlnutos onto an oxlsUng route Is projoctod 10 rosult
In 7,103 additional vohlclo hourll annually. In FY92, tho Incromontal cost of adding now sorvlco
Is ostlmatod to bo $18.84 por hour. This costlncludos drlvor wagos and bonollts, and vohlclo
oporatlng oxponsos. Thoroforo, tho lolal annual costin FV92 Is projoctod to bo $132,400. This
cost projoctlon assumos tho use 01 pormanont drivors lor tho oxpandod sorvlco. Tho use of
tomporary ompleyoos unllltho luluro of tho now routo Is dotormlnod would roduco tho proposal's
cosl. A portion 01 this cost would bo covorod by larobox rovonuo. Whllo systom.wldo 10wII CIIy
Transit rocovors approxlmatoly 30% Itom Iho larobox, I om ostlmatlng that this now route would
rocovor 20% (atloaslln tho flrsl yoar). This thon roducos tho lolal cost down 10 $105,920.
Tho Iowa DOT admlnlstors the Stato Transit Asslslanco (STA) lundlng ptogrom dlsporslng a
portlen of tho Rood Uso Tox procoods to Iranslt sysloms In Iowa. A provision 01 this ptogrom Is
callod spoclal proJoct monlos which arc meant to oncourago Innovatlvo and/or exporlmontal
sorvlce concopts. Thoso lunds aro ofton uSod to lund a portion 01 tho first yoar cosls of now
sorvlco. Whllo tho DOT Air and Transit Division Dlroctot cannot at this limo absolutoly guaranloo
tho gran ling olspoclal projoctlunds for Ihls proposal, ho did loll mo 'It was vory IIkoly'tho DOT
would lund up to 50% of tho first yoar costs. Final approval 01 OUt toquost will not bo posslblo
unlll AprlVMay, 1991. Assuming approval or tho DOT funds,lho rosulllng not cosllo tho City 01
Iowa CIIy In FV92 Is osllmatod 10 be $52,975.

17.00 Purposo. Tho purposos ot this sootIon IIrOl
A. TO insuro tho propor oporlltIon,ot All oxIstIng Dnd tuturo
onsite wastowater troatmont and dIsposal lIystOlftS in ordor to
proteot tho publIc health And the onvironmont.
B. To 1I110w tor tho propor uso ot hiqh mAIntonanco,
innovativo, or IIltornatIvo onsito wastAwAtor troatmont and
disposal lIystoms whora "convontIonal" onsite systomll are not
Appropriate. \
17.01 DilltrIct boundarIos. Tho boundarIos ot tho OnsIto Walltewater
Hanagomont DistrIct Aro tho boundarIos ot Johnson County, IOWA.
17.02 Tho Board may roquIre cortAIn provIsIons bo mot In accordAnco
wIth theso regulAtions tor tho constructIon, mAIntenAnco, And
IftAnaqemont ot onsIto wastowator troatment and disposal lIystomll
locatod In oxIstInq or proposod subdIvIsIons.
A. proposod subdIvIsions. Evory propollod lIubdivIsIon ~n_l'"
- nt' moro .P~!I~tod.lotl\JjI roquIrod to joIn_tho. OWllll. Tho aotor-
mInation on tho InoluBIOn of Q proposod subdIvIoIon with 4 to
14 plAtted lots wIll bo modo by tho Board And will bo basod on
one or moro ot tho tollowIng crItorIal
43
. .,...,~

1. 20 porcont of lots having sovore site limitations, whioh
inoludo but ore not limited tOI (0) porcolation ratell
excooding 60 m~nutes por inch (b) ovidonco of high
groundwator table, (0) evidonco of an undorlying glaoial
till within six feet of the surfaco of the ground, (d)
slopes groator than 20\ in proposod absorption areas,
(e) drainageways or watercoursos, (f) scalping or '
filling of lots, (g) flood plain easoments or utility
easoDonts, (h) proposed and existing well locationll, and
(i) subdividor's convonants.
2. 20 porcent of lotll on which IIlternative wastewllter
treatmont and 'disposal systems lire proposed tor use.
3. Proposod use of sharod wastewater treatmont and disposal
systoms by two or more lot ownors.
4. Othor conditions or fllctors that might affeot tho
performance of wllstewater treatment and disposlll sYlltoms
or contribute to ~he dogrlldation of the environmont.
If tho Boord stipulates that 0 propolled subdivision mUllt join
tho OWHD, this information and any pertinont agreements or
understandings sholl be included in tho Subdivider's Agreement
pursuant to Artiole XXII of tho Johnson County Zoning
Ordinance.

C. A visual inspection of every wastewater absorption area
will be made, at leallt ovary two yoars. All inapootion ports
will be oponed at that time. If thero is ovid once ot a
possible problom from tho visual inspoction, a repair pormit
must be issued by tho Board betoro ropairs can be made.
D. Wastewater systoms that emPlOY mochaniclIl oquipment must be
inspooted IInnually and routine ma ntonanca portormed.
E. othor 1I1ternative wastewater treatment and dillpollal IIYlltels
must be inspocted annually. Altornativo systels must also be
maintainod according to manUfacturers' spocificlltions.
,
Roporting. Minutes trom tho district committoo moetingo will
be submittod to tho Board within 30 working days,tollowing each
moeting. Inspoction reports, maintonance rocommendations, and
maintenanco records will be oubmittod by tho committoe to tho
Boord on a quarterly basis. Tho Boord may roquellt records as
it doems nocessary to proteot publio hoalth IInd satety.
Default cllluse.
A. In the event that the committoe fails to moet its obliga-
tions as outlined in those rules and rogulationll, the Board
will act to on force these rules and regulationll.
B. In tho evont the committee oncounters prOblems, rofullals or
negloct of rosponsibilitios from district property ownors,
IIppropriate action to forco complillnco with distriot rulos and
rogulations will bo token. Tho committoo may roquost
IIssistanco from tho Board to accomplish this. '
Financial responsibilities. Tho proporty ownors within the
OIfHD will be financially lillble for the costll ot oporllting the
district.
Licensing and cortification. Wastewater sYlltem contractorll and
septic tank pumpers must satisfactorily completo all tho desig-
nated requirements as determinod by the Boord. Thill inoludoa
but is not limitod to Section 14.02 of those rules.
17.17 Amendments. Adminlstrative procedures and tees may be amended
os recommended by the Boord and approved by tho Johnson County
Board of Supervlsors.

In response to your momo dated October 12, 1990, the eight
light poles removed from Mercer Park Field 12 are for sale. It is
the City's usual policy that the disposition of IIU surplus
proparty must be lIold at public lIuction, or by a public bidding
process. In viow of our working rolationship with the school
systom, however, we have decided it would be appropriate to allow,
you the opportunity to purchllse these poles at their estimated
value of $3.720. This estimate WIIS obtained from Pioneer Pole
Company, located in Des Moines.
Four of the poles moasure 50 feet in length, IInd the other
four moasure 60 feet in length. Each of them includes wooden
cross-arms which clln bo utilized, if needed, to attach light'
fixtures.
If you are interosted in purchasing these poles lit their
estimated vlllue, please contact me by Monday, Hovelllber 19,' if
, possible.

You and oth~r members (It the CouncIl ralecd certain concerns (It a
recent lneellng regardln{l the Galwo}' III lie open Dpace-parkland
cCmpl'Omlfle. In tho end. you and th... Counci I llupported our poeition
but. I thi nk. es II leep ot tll ith rother then tundamenta I agreement.
My concern is th~t the Counci I fJometimes measures our SUCcess by
how badly we nicked the developer and not on the merits ot the
development. 1 think our plan tor Galway HIlls ill wiDe both trom
a phYlllcal standpoint clnd trom an economic standpoint.
Parkland lIcquiHition should be contingent upon development Dize.
density and proximity to other recreational DerVlcea and open
space. When backyardll exceed an acre I don't thInk it III
incumbent on the city to provIde eWingDets and slIdes tor tots-
that in a concern ot the IndIVIdual property ownera. Rather. its
our Job to prOVide protectIon ot natural teatures and t~cillties
which serve and I ink Dubdivislonll and neiqhbClrhoodll. Extractions
trom devele>pers t1hould be Ullod to tODter thODO endll. The Planning
and Zoning CommiSSIon i8 !ltrongly in llupport ot these prIncipleD
and 1 thInk many ot th08e on the P~rkfJ ~nd RecreatIon Comrnislllon
concur.
The resulllng ~lan tor Galway HIlls currently Includes Hix acres
along Wi Ilow Creek. ThIS Ie the toundatlon tor a (rreenbel t and
he>petully a nature tr~ll that WIll prOVide recreatIonal opportunity
tor adults and chIldren alIke. Such a traIl could ultimately
link pedllstrillll trattic to the IIlgh School and eOI've an area trom
Willow Creek P~l'k to Iii(lhway 216. It you want to improve on the
pllln. hllve the developer escrow lunda tOl' btlrmlng. plantinqe and
trail development alona Willow Cro~k.
Thill ill not II lltnctly phYIIIl'~1 [llannln\! concern: Hll an economic
one atl well. You hove heard the I'otlonale that higher development
coetD move developeI'll olltalde tho Cay MId hamper attordablo
houlling, However. tho economIc rationale that I om concerned
. '--~-'4"_''''':_;'f.'~\': \~'.;"';"..".,' !:~:,
" \'ti

with 10 Inore IIrllledlote - the recreatlon budget. In tht.! past we
havo extracted land whIch the cIty haD been very reluctant to
accept Illuntero Runl due to limited Inalntenance (unds. With thlo
In mind. can wo really "ltord to InOlntain omall parko In evo:ry new
development? Should we be tocuolng our recroatlon rooources In
areao where the median houoo 10 priced over $17~.OOO and tho
density 10 leBO than two unlto per acre? I don't think eo.
I think the Galway 1I111u open opace plan Ie a \lood one In that it
allowa un to preserve wetlands. prOVIde approprIate recreational
apace and prOVIde pecteBtrlan I Ink!! WIthIn tho neIghborhood. It
dooo DO at a relatively low coot: tor both capllal Improvements
and future maintenance.
Conveniently enou\lh. thore are places In Iowa City where the
denSIty approachoD 145 unite pOl' acre and recreatIonal racllltieo
are virtually non-6xlotont. Inner CIty aroan oouth of Burlinqton
that have Increaood populatIon and density many tImes more tllM
outlYIng oubdlvlslonll. Maintenance and capital resources saved
from the outskIrts Ilhould b" devoted to Inner-CitY recreatlon-
specifically the rIver corrIdor.
This IS a letter of explanation. At oome point over the next
six monthll our taok force with the acronym F.I.R.S.T. (friends ot
the Iowa River Scenic Trail) WIll bo comln\l to city council with
opoclflc propooale and further explanation. We WIll continue to
appreCIate your suppor.t.
